Overview of Big Stone Gap Demographics

The demographics of Big Stone Gap offer invaluable insights into the composition, dynamics and needs of both urban and rural areas, empowering planners, developers and policymakers to foster prosperity, equity, and well-being for all residents. With a population of 5,403, Big Stone Gap exhibits a population density of 1,101 people per square mile, contrasting with the national average of 91. The median age stands at 39.3, with 51% of individuals aged 15 or older being married and 36% having children under 18. In terms of income equality in Big Stone Gap, 33% of households report a median income below $25,000, while 12% report an income exceeding $150,000, showcasing a diverse economic landscape.

Big Stone Gap Racial Demographics & Ethnicity

Recognizing the racial demographics and ethnicity breakdown of Big Stone Gap is pivotal for addressing systemic inequities, championing social justice and inclusion and fostering resilient communities. In Big Stone Gap, the racial breakdown comprises 72.2% White, 23.9% Black or African American, 1.7% Asian, 0.1% American Indian, and 0% Native Hawaiian, with 1.9% of the population identifying as Hispanic or Latino. 95.8% of households reported speaking English only, while 1.8% reported speaking Spanish only. Furthermore, 2.1% of residents were categorized as foreign-born.

      Race Big Stone Gap Virginia National
      White 72.24% 68.75% 73.35%
      Black 23.92% 19.21% 12.63%
      Asian 1.71% 6.05% 5.22%
      American Indian 0.13% 0.26% 0.82%
      Native Hawaiian 0.00% 0.07% 0.18%
      Mixed race 1.75% 3.37% 3.06%
      Other race 0.25% 2.30% 4.75%
      In Big Stone Gap, 1.9% of people are of Hispanic or Latino origin.
      Please note: Hispanics may be of any race, so also are included in any/all of the applicable race categories above.
